Summary
Coin; Sixpence contained in a knitted fully beaded erctangular purse with a grey background with pink and white roses and green leaves with the lower part copper brown on a pinchbeck frame. The note in the purse is in Charles Wade's writing? 'Granny Bulwer'. Also a silver sixpence 1839. (female)
Provenance
Given to National Trust with Snowshill Manor in 1951 by Charles Paget Wade
